Bloodstained: Ritual of the Night will now be coming to the Switch instead of Wii U

In a surprisingly turn of events, Bloodstained: Ritual of the Night will no longer be a Wii U title. Instead, it's moving to the Nintendo Switch.

Bloodstained: Ritual of the Night is an exploration-based, side-scrolling platformer with elements of RPG. You play as Miriam, an orphan scarred by an alchemist curse which slowly crystallises your skin, as you fight through a demon-filled castle.

The response since its campaign release has been phenomenal, not only reaching its goal of $500,000 but exceeding it dramatically - $5-million more, to be exact.

Koji Igarashi stated on the game's Kickstarter earlier this week: "During our Kickstarter campaign, the Wii U was at the height of its popularity, but the situation has drastically changed after the release of Nintendo Switch. This change made it difficult to receive the necessary support from the hardware maker, which has led us to drop the Wii U development and shift the development to Nintendo Switch."
However, Mr Igarashi gives backers of the Wii U version the option to pull out. "We are very sorry that it has come to this after all your support, but we hope you will understand. We would like to respond by preparing options for our backers, such as moving your pledge to another version or requesting a refund if you don’t want any other version."

The game will still come to PS4, Xbox One, PC, and Vita as originally planned.
